草庐IT

jaws-screen-reader

全部标签

python - 为多次迭代重置 csv.reader 的正确方法?

自定义迭代器存在问题,因为它只会迭代文件一次。我打电话seek(0)在迭代之间的相关文件对象上,但是StopIteration第一次调用next()时抛出2号运行。我觉得我忽略了一些明显的东西,但会欣赏一些新的眼光:classMappedIterator(object):"""Givenaniteratorofdictsorobjectsandaattributemappingdict,willmaketheobjectsaccessibleviathedesiredinterface.Currentlyitwillonlyproducedictionarieswithstringva

Python 异步 : reader callback and coroutine communication

我正在尝试实现一个将数据从标准输入传递到协程的简单想法:importasyncioimportsysevent=asyncio.Event()defhandle_stdin():data=sys.stdin.readline()event.data=data#NOTE:dataassignedtotheeventobjectevent.set()@asyncio.coroutinedeftick():while1:print('Tick')yieldfromasyncio.sleep(1)ifevent.is_set():data=event.data#NOTE:datareadfro

python - 属性错误 : 'module' object has no attribute 'reader'

这个问题在这里已经有了答案:Importinginstalledpackagefromscriptwiththesamenameraises"AttributeError:modulehasnoattribute"or"ImportError:cannotimportname"(2个答案)关闭5年前。我得到错误:AttributeError:'module'objecthasnoattribute'reader')当我运行下面的代码但我不明白为什么?importcsvwithopen('test.csv')asf:q=csv.reader(f)

python - 为什么我不能为 csv.Reader 重复 'for' 循环?

我是Python初学者。我现在正在尝试弄清楚为什么第二个“for”循环在以下脚本中不起作用。我的意思是我只能得到第一个“for”循环的结果,而不能从第二个循环中得到任何结果。我在下面复制并粘贴了我的脚本和数据csv。如果您能告诉我为什么会这样,以及如何使第二个“for”循环也能正常工作,那将很有帮助。我的脚本:importcsvfile="data.csv"fh=open(file,'rb')read=csv.DictReader(fh)foreinread:print(e['a'])foreinread:print(e['b'])“数据.csv”:a,b,ctree,bough,tr

html - JAWS 未读取 Aria-Live ="Assertive"

你好Stackoverflow社区。这是我的第一个问题,但我会尽量简明扼要。我的任务是更新我们的ASP.NETWeb应用程序以符合第508节的要求。这对我来说都是全新的,我很难让事情按预期工作。我们有一个页面,用户可以通过onmouseover事件获取有关链接的附加信息。显然,这不适用于视力不佳的用户。因此,我们为他们提供了一个“更多信息”按钮,该按钮显示与视力正常的用户相同的“工具提示”div。我将aria-live="assertive添加到“tooltip”div并理解如果div在页面加载时隐藏然后通过按钮显示,它会被JAWS读取.令我沮丧的是,事实并非如此。工具提示div如下所

jquery - CSS 或 jQuery : Make last div fill the rest of the screen height

我有一组3个元素需要在初始屏幕上看到,而这些元素下方的正文中的内容需要位于初始屏幕底部下方,但用户仍然需要能够加载后滚动到所有内容。这方面的完美示例是dropbox.com上的登录页面(注销时)。无论用户缩小多少,该行下方的元素都位于其下方,直到用户向下滚动才可见。我正在寻找一个好的CSS或jQuery解决方案。我看过this但我不能简单地将这3个元素绝对化。对我来说最好的方法是将第3个div的高度扩展到初始屏幕的底部,我该怎么做?编辑:我总共有大约6个div,我只希望前3个可见,而其余的必须低于初始屏幕边界。编辑:这是div布局的图片: 最佳答案

iphone - iOs 5 Safari 新特性 "reader",开发者如何使用?

这个问题在这里已经有了答案:关闭10年前。PossibleDuplicate:HowtoenableiOS5SafariReaderonmywebsite?所以iOS5MobileSafari具有这个新的阅读器功能,但我不明白它在我的网站上是如何工作的,也不知道我作为网络开发人员可以做些什么来确保网页与“阅读器”兼容。有谁知道我在哪里可以找到这方面的文档,我知道它仍处于测试阶段,但某处应该仍然有文档。据我所知,它似乎在寻找RSS提要?谁能详细说说?

jquery - 图像映射 : Click to echo/print text on screen

是否可以单击图像映射的一部分并打印出一些文本,例如alt或title那的值(value)在页面某处标记?我可以通过jQuery做到这一点吗?我已经看过并且正在努力这样做(对jQuery非常生疏,并且是一个新手)。我玩过一些代码,但我设法得到的只是静态数据。谢谢。编辑:这是一张包含30个大小和形状独特的可点击“区域”的大图像。 最佳答案 HTML:jQuery:$(function(){$('maparea').click(function(){alert($(this).attr('alt'));});});

javascript - Firefox 22 mozGetUserMedia 使用 'screen' 作为设备源

关于Firefox22中的WebRTC支持已经有一些传言。这是为了解Firefox开发的人准备的:Firefox中是否支持桌面屏幕捕获?Chrome26+确实存在该技术,它为屏幕捕获提供了实验性支持(使用“屏幕”作为设备源);实现这一目标的代码(片段)是://selectanysupportedgetUserMediafunctionnavigator.getMedia=(navigator.getUserMedia||navigator.webkitGetUserMedia||navigator.mozGetUserMedia||navigator.msGetUserMedia);/

html - CSS 宽度 :100% not fitting the screen

我试图让我的页脚位于页面的末尾,所以我使用position:absolute和bottom:0来做到这一点。问题是背景颜色不会扩展以适合屏幕,所以我尝试使用width:100%但现在它有额外的像素这是我创建的示例http://jsfiddle.net/SRuyG/2/(抱歉有点乱,我才刚开始学css)我还尝试了一些我发现的教程中的粘性页脚,但它也不起作用。那么究竟如何才能将页脚设置到页面底部并且背景适合屏幕大小呢?谢谢CSS:html,body{margin:0;padding:0;}body{font:13px/22pxHelvetica,Arial,sans-serif;backg